Virtual Technologies Group (Jacmel Growth Partners) acquires Whitlock IS
TARGET
Whitlock IS
Whitlock IS delivers IT operations management consulting, managed services, and software solutions to enterprise organizations across energy, defense, financial, and technology sectors.

ACQUIRER
Virtual Technologies Group
Virtual Technologies Group provides managed IT infrastructure, cybersecurity, cloud services, and VoIP solutions to commercial enterprises, government agencies, education organizations, and non-profits.
